Transaction 3732d08bd1d5e223cb5edef64c5e4f770e9df2d2eb052995b1734d266121ca1e

block
d6c42beb87fce3a941933a44e8a063e098e6c9a33cf538160e18bbdaf8cb33a0

1 Input

23 Outputs